Xi Jinping Welcomes Brunei Sultan in Beijing Ceremony ๐ŸŒŸ

Chinese President Xi Jinping rolled out the red carpet for Brunei's Sultan Haji Hassanal Bolkiah Mu'izzaddin Waddaulah on Thursday, hosting a grand welcome ceremony at Beijing's iconic Great Hall of the People. The Sultan's state visit (Feb 5-7) marks a fresh chapter in ASEAN-China relations, with both sides eyeing deeper economic and cultural collaboration. ๐Ÿ›๏ธโœจ

Against the backdrop of China's 30th anniversary of dialogue relations with ASEAN, the leaders discussed plans to supercharge collaboration in green energy, digital economy projects, and cultural exchanges. ๐ŸŒฑ๐Ÿ’ก Analysts say the visit could turbocharge Brunei's Vision 2035 goals through tech partnerships and Belt and Road synergies.
